    A look inside Google's secretive ATAP group

    Published on Jun 26, 2014

    Some of the most amazing projects at Google are coming out of its Advanced Technologies and Products group, a team lead by ex-DARPA director Regina Dugan. Today at Google I/O, ATAP showcased some of the most impressive projects that it's working on right now: the spatially aware Project Tango tablet, the modular Project Ara smartphone, and a CGI short film called Duet.

    Google Research's Projects at Maker Faire

    Published on May 24, 2015

    Google had a big presence at this year's Maker Faire, bring several of their research projects to share with makers--including a giant knife-wielding robot! We chat with Chris DiBona, Google's director of Making Science, about experiments in imagery, 3D printing, robotics, and aerial Wi-Fi.
